baza danych szkoły

0

Witam, potrzebuje pomocy.
Mam do zrobienia bazę danych szkoły.

Zrobiłem takie tabele, które możecie zobaczyć w w załączniku.

Tylko teraz jak to połączyć?

Pozdrawiam. Z góry dziękuję za pomoc, stawiam piwo :-D

0

To portal programistów nie wróżek. Same nazwy tabel nic nikomu nie powiedzą. Pokaż struktury tabel (kolumny).

0

Tylko teraz jak to połączyć?

Należy połączyć kluczami obcymi

Np.

ALTER TABLE `klasa`  
  ADD CONSTRAINT FOREIGN KEY (`id`) REFERENCES `uczen` (`id_klasy`) ON DELETE CASCADE ON UPDATE CASCADE,
0

Struktury

0

Zasada jest taka jeśli masz ID tabeli i chcesz połączyć ją z inną tabelą dodajesz do drugiej tabeli FK tak jak to przedstawił Georghinio ale dodatkowo ID tabeli (klasy) trzymasz w tej drugiej tabeli (szkoła) i po nim łączysz tabele. Przykład
ID w tabeli klasy będzie połączone z tabelką szkoła ale w tabelce szkoła musisz mieć ID (szkoły) i ID_klasy, które jest polem, gdzie trzymasz ID klasy.

1 użytkowników online, w tym zalogowanych: 0, gości: 1